Does anybody know wether my Philips DVD+RWD01 (delivered with Dell computer) is DVD+R compatible. Any hints would be helpfull!

Checked the Dell website and they use both the HP DVD200 series DVD+RW and LaCie Firewire DVD-RW for drives. Both do R & RW media. JMB you probably got an eariler version Dell that used the Philips DVD+RW that will record R & RW media.
Kennyshin, I would love to see this electronic miracle you are talking about that will only write to RW media. Who makes it and where can I find one? -
Well you can find one at Bestbuy for around 500...its the Philips dvd+rw 200 series. It claims it can read and write to +r but it cant. Now I just posted a message in this forum on how to get the updated drive its self. Just take a look.
